California Lavash was founded more than 25 years ago by Ms. Eshoo’s parents, using a grandmother’s traditional recipe. A staple of Middle Eastern cuisine, lavash is a soft, thin flatbread.
The nosh lavash rolls elevate the Yiddish snack to a filling meal by packing the lavash bread with meats, vegetables and cheese. The rolls are served with a side of rosemary potatoes.
